English: Associate Professor Selina Tusitala Marsh ONZM, 2017-19 New Zealand Poet Laureate and notable Pacific scholar, has been awarded the Humanities Aronui Medal by Royal Society Te Apārangi for her outstanding creative and scholarly work which has had a profound impact in academic, literary and public domains. This was at Research Honours Aotearoa, an annual awards ceremony that recognises achievements and contributions of innovators, kairangahau Māori, researchers and scholars in science, technology and humanities throughout Aotearoa New Zealand, which was held in Ōtepoti Dunedin on 17 Whiringa-ā-nuku October 2019.
